Web Developer - Mid Level
Recruiter
Listed on
Location
Salary/Rate
Type
This job has now expired please search on the home page to find live IT Jobs.
Job Title: Web Developer - Mid-Level
Job Type: Employment or External
This is an opportunity to join a fast growing novelty gifts company based in Cardiff, Wales. Their online stores are present in all English speaking countries as well as Germany, France and Spain. They have a technology-first approach to building and launching new innovative products and they are looking to further expand their operations to other markets, as well as consolidate their positions in the ones they already activate.
About the role
This is an exciting opportunity to work on entirely new and unique projects! They are a small team so you will work closely with everyone in the company. This means you'll work on many exciting tasks like prototyping new customer funnels (i.e. Landing pages, A/B testing different features), and updating current websites to suit business needs.
They use a variety of technologies to maintain and develop their websites and infrastructure: PHP, JavaScript (AngularJS, canvas), RabbitMQ, CUPS, GoLang, various AWS services (EC2, Lambda, SES, etc.). You will join a small development team and mainly be responsible for the PrestaShop stores that are already deployed. You will work closely with other developers, as well as Marketing and their CEO to launch new features and update the current websites.
The Job is in Cardiff however we are open to applicants that are looking to work remotely.
Essential skills
- All-around knowledge of PHP, having used it on previous jobs
- Understand the basics of themes and templating systems (like smarty)
- Good knowledge of JavaScript, HTML, CSS, MySQL
- Ability to work independently and self-manage tasks
- Good knowledge of GIT
Desired skills
- Experience with an e-commerce platform (PrestaShop is a big plus)
- Responsive design
- AngularJS
- Automated testing using tools like Selenium
- Server Deployment & Management
- Linux
- Nginx
- Experience with consuming REST APIs
Responsibilities:
- Implement new features and changes into existing systems
- Maintain current systems and codebase
- Assist others in troubleshooting technical problems
- Develop tools that will automate and streamline bottlenecks in their processes
- Work closely with Marketing to develop and A/B test new features